Built as an H-frame rather than a simple straight beam, the Machining & Welding 4000 LB 10 FT Economy H-Beam covers 4 by 10 feet at 4,000 pounds capacity, ideal for loads that need support on more than one axis.

Because the frame spans both dimensions of the load, it distributes weight more evenly across the rigging than a single straight lift beam would.

Steel construction throughout gives the frame the stiffness needed to keep a wide load level, even when weight is not perfectly centered.

An H-beam is a straightforward way to add lift points without engineering a custom spreader for every oversized load that comes through the shop.

Before putting any lifting equipment into service, verify it matches your hoist or crane setup and confirm the rated capacity covers your heaviest expected load with margin to spare. Routine inspection of welds, pins, and connection hardware helps catch wear before it becomes a safety issue. Keep a simple inspection log if your facility does not already have one, since tracking wear over time makes it easier to plan replacement before a part actually fails in use.

Equipment that sees daily use benefits from a quick visual check every time it comes out of storage, not just during scheduled inspections. Catching a small issue, like surface corrosion or a bent component, before it becomes a larger problem keeps rigging hardware safe and in service longer.
